Bible Person

Darius

Meaning: he that informs himself · Male · 1 cross reference

This Darius entry refers to the Persian ruler named in Nehemiah 12, not to the Darius figures more prominent in Ezra and Daniel. He belongs to the imperial backdrop of the post-exilic priestly record. First appears in Neh 12:22.1

AI summary: This Darius matters because his single cross reference situates the succession of priestly and Levitical heads within a wider Persian political timeframe. Even a brief royal marker helps place the restored community inside larger imperial history. Taken together, the material presents this Darius as a chronological ruler-reference in the post-exilic setting.1
